  • Mark 9:11-13
    Then they asked him,“ Why do the experts in the law say that Elijah must come first?”He said to them,“ Elijah does indeed come first, and restores all things. And why is it written that the Son of Man must suffer many things and be despised?But I tell you that Elijah has certainly come, and they did to him whatever they wanted, just as it is written about him.”
  • Malachi 4:5
    Look, I will send you Elijah the prophet before the great and terrible day of the LORD arrives.
  • Luke 1:17
    And he will go as forerunner before the Lord in the spirit and power of Elijah, to turn the hearts of the fathers back to their children and the disobedient to the wisdom of the just, to make ready for the Lord a people prepared for him.”
  • Matthew 17:10-13
    The disciples asked him,“ Why then do the experts in the law say that Elijah must come first?”He answered,“ Elijah does indeed come first and will restore all things.And I tell you that Elijah has already come. Yet they did not recognize him, but did to him whatever they wanted. In the same way, the Son of Man will suffer at their hands.”Then the disciples understood that he was speaking to them about John the Baptist.

  • John 1:21-23
    So they asked him,“ Then who are you? Are you Elijah?” He said,“ I am not!”“ Are you the Prophet?” He answered,“ No!”Then they said to him,“ Who are you? Tell us so that we can give an answer to those who sent us. What do you say about yourself?”John said,“ I am the voice of one shouting in the wilderness,‘ Make straight the way for the Lord,’ as Isaiah the prophet said.”
